#d7c392 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d7c392 is composed of 84.3% red, 76.5%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9.3% magenta, 32.1%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 42.6 degrees, a saturation of 46.3% and a lightness of 70.8%. #d7c392 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#af8725.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

● #d7c392 color description : Slightly desaturated orange.
#d7c392 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d7c392 has RGB values of R:215, G:195,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.09, Y:0.32,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14140306.

Shades and Tints of #d7c392
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060502 is the darkest color, while #fcfaf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d7c392
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b5b5b4 is the less saturated color, while #f9d170 is the most saturated one.
